California HMO Report Card Finds Limited Improvement From 2005

None of the nine largest HMOs in California was rated as “excellent” in the report card, leading some consumer advocates to question why the report hasn’t translated to greater quality improvements among HMOs. This is the seventh annual release of the report. Los Angeles Daily News et al.

Democrats Study Options After Kids’ Health Veto Override Fails

The House was 13 votes short of overriding President Bush’s veto of the State Children’s Health Insurance Program bill. Democrats say they will discuss the bill but are standing firm on the provision to cover four million additional children. Wall Street Journal et al.

Presidential Candidates Tackle Health Care

Democratic presidential candidate Sen. Hillary Rodham Clinton called her health care proposal a “sensible, centrist” framework for health care reform. Meanwhile, Republican presidential candidate former New York City Mayor Rudy Giuliani voiced his support for President Bush’s veto of the State Children’s Health Insurance Program legislation.
